WebAbout CCB. Since 1999 the Compliance Certification Board (CCB) ® has developed criteria to determine competence in the practice of compliance and ethics across various industries and specialty areas, and recognizes individuals meeting these criteria through its compliance certification programs. WebLPEC certification shows that you have the requisite, working knowledge to build and sustain thriving E&C programs to the highest possible standard. LPEC Certification requires 6 CEU hours (fulfilled by E2C training) and passing the 80-question proctored LPEC exam. The exam fee is $250, and is delivered online via Examity. http://www.ethics.state.fl.us/Training/Training.aspx

AMAZING APRIL SALE! 🤩 25% off on all PDF Certs & Diplomas - Now On! how to use my stuff on huluWebOGE is responsible for issuing and interpreting the Standards of Ethical Conduct for Employees of the Executive Branch. OGE provides professional development opportunities for executive branch ethics officials through its Institute for Ethics in Government. Since 1999 the Compliance Certification Board (CCB) ® has developed criteria to determine competence in the practice of compliance and ethics across various … how to use my subaru appWebOregon Basic Police certification is required for and can only be held by full-time police officers. Full-time police officers are defined as individuals working over 80 hours a month for 3 consecutive months with the responsibility of enforcing criminal law.
